#!/bin/sh # chromium-runtests.sh [testsuite] # Script to run a respectable subset of Chromium's test suite # (excepting parts that run the browser itself, and excepting layout tests). # Run from parent of src directory. # By default, runs all test suites. If you specify one testsuite # (e.g. base_unittests), it only runs that one. # # Chromium's test suite uses gtest, so each executable obeys the options # documented in the wiki at http://code.google.com/p/googletest # In particular, you can run a single test with --gtest_filter=Foo.Bar, # and get a full list of tests in each exe with --gtest_list_tests. # # Before running the tests, regardless of operating system: # 1) Make sure your system has at least one printer installed, # or printing_unittests and unit_tests' PrintJobTest.SimplePrint # will fail. A fake printer is fine, nothing will be printed. # 2) Install the test cert as described at # http://bugs.winehq.org/show_bug.cgi?id=20370 # or net_unittests' HTTPSRequestTest.*, SSLClientSocketTest.* # and others may fail. # # Chrome doesn't start without the --no-sandbox # option in wine, so skip test suites that invoke it directly until I # figure out how to jam that in there. usage() { cat <<_EOF_ Usage: sh chromium-runtests.sh [--options] [suite ...] Runs chromium tests on Windows or Wine, optionally with valgrind. Stdout/stderr saved to logs/ directory. (The tests themselves may save logs next to their executables in src/Debug.) Options: --individual - run tests individually --just-crashes - run only tests epected to crash --just-fails - run only tests epected to fail --just-flaky - run only tests epected to fail sometimes --just-hangs - run only tests epected to hang --list-failures - show list of expected failures --loops N - run tests N times -n - dry run, only show what will be done --valgrind - run the tests under valgrind --winedebug chan - e.g. --windebug +relay,+seh Currently supported suites: app_unittests base_unittests courgette_unittests googleurl_unittests ipc_tests media_unittests net_unittests printing_unittests sbox_unittests sbox_validation_tests setup_unittests tcmalloc_unittests unit_tests Default is to run all suites.
